Методический анализ учебного материала по теме «Языки программирования баз данных и СУБД»

Актуально о образовании » Методический анализ темы "Языки программирования баз данных и СУБД" » Методический анализ учебного материала по теме «Языки программирования баз данных и СУБД»

Страница 3

Сетевые базы данных подобны иерархическим, за исключением того, что в них имеются указатели в обоих направлениях, которые соединяют родственную информацию. Несмотря на то, что эта модель решает некоторые проблемы, связанные с иерархической моделью, выполнение простых запросов остается достаточно сложным процессом. Также, поскольку логика процедуры выборки данных зависит от физической организации этих данных, то эта модель не является полностью независимой от приложения. Другими словами если необходимо изменить структуру данных, то нужно изменить и приложение.

Многомерные базы данных OLAP (On-line Analytical Processing) - программное обеспечение OLAP используется при обработке данных из различных источников. Эти программные продукты позволяют реализовать множество различных представлений данных и характеризуются тремя основными чертами: многомерное представление данных; сложные вычисления над данными; вычисления, связанные с изменением данных во времени.

Реляционная база данных — база данных, основанная на реляционной модели. Слово «реляционный» происходит от английского «relation» (отношение).

Теория реляционных баз данных была разработана доктором Коддом из компании IBM в 1970 году. В реляционных базах данных все данные представлены в виде простых таблиц, разбитых на строки и столбцы, на пересечении которых расположены данные. Запросы к таким таблицам возвращают таблицы, которые сами могут становиться предметом дальнейших запросов. Каждая база данных может включать несколько таблиц. Кратко особенности реляционной базы данных можно сформулировать следующим образом:

Данные хранятся в таблицах, состоящих из столбцов ("атрибутов") и строк ("записей", "кортежей" );

На пересечении каждого столбца и строчки стоит в точности одно значение;

У каждого столбца есть своё имя, которое служит его названием, и все значения в одном столбце имеют один тип.

Запросы к базе данных возвращают результат в виде таблиц, которые тоже могут выступать как объект запросов.

Строки в реляционной базе данных неупорядочены - упорядочивание производится в момент формирования ответа на запрос. Общепринятым стандартом языка работы с реляционными базами данных является язык SQL.

Объектно-ориентированная база данных — база данных, в которой данные оформлены в виде моделей объектов, включающих прикладные программы, которые управляются внешними событиями.

Основная практическая надобность в ООБД связана с потребностью в некоторой интегрированной среде построения сложных информационных систем. В этой среде должны отсутствовать противоречия между структурной и поведенческой частями проекта и должно поддерживаться эффективное управление сложными структурами данных во внешней памяти.

К настоящему моменту неизвестен какой-либо язык программирования ООБД, который был бы спроектирован целиком заново, начиная с нуля. Естественным подходом к построению такого языка было использование (с необходимыми расширениями) некоторого существующего объектно-ориентированного языка. Начало расцвета направления ООБД совпало с пиком популярности языка Smalltalk-80. Этот язык оказал большое влияние на разработку первых систем ООБД, и в частности, использовался в качестве языка программирования.[3]

Трудности с эффективной практической реализацией языка Smalltalk побудили разработчиков систем ООБД к поиску альтернативных базовых языков. Известная близость объектно-ориентированного и функционального подходов к программированию позволяет достаточно успешно опираться на функциональные языки программирования. В частности, язык Лисп (Common Lisp) является основой проекта ORION. В этом проекте Лисп является и инструментальным языком, и базой объектно-ориентированного языка программирования в среде ORION.

Страницы: 1 2 3 4 5 6 7 8

Подробно о педагогике:

Механизмы макроуправления образованием
Успешность управления региональной образовательной системой зависит в значительной степени от успешности проектной деятельности, которая представляет собой ядро управленческой деятельности и от того, насколько качественными получаются продукты этой деятельности, воплощенные в проектно - нормативную ...

Развитие зрительных функций с помощью компьютерных игр у дошкольников с нарушением зрения
Большую часть информации об окружающем мире дети дошкольного возраста получают благодаря зрению, и именно зрение играет ведущую роль в развитии познавательных способностей ребенка и формировании его жизненного опыта. У детей с нарушениями бинокулярного зрения, такими как косоглазие, амблиопия и ани ...

Эстетическое воспитание учащихся 10-11 классов в процессе обучения проектированию одежды как социально-педагогическая проблема
В наше время, в условиях интенсивного развития конкурентной борьбы за рынок сбыта, проблема эстетического воспитания является особой. Оно развивает вкус, умение замечать прекрасное и безобразное. При эстетическом воспитании, вооружение учащихся эстетическими знаниями и навыками, включение его в лич ...

Разделы

Copyright © 2024 - All Rights Reserved - www.educationtheory.ru